as far as traction...you didnt make any mention to any suspension or radial/slick upgrades that you have!!
as far weight reduction..you pretty much have a good start (get above taken care of 1st)
as far et?....??????? get to the track!!!...i've seen people w/ 300whp not get into 12's and i've seen 200whp in the 11's

get the trunk molded to fiberglass or CF ... look at JDM companies mayeb they already make one for Ferio or whatever its called there.
heater core, bumper supports, inner door supports rear seat cross frame that separates the trunk you can cut out, cut out all metal ont he rear doors and just leave a shell.
assume this is not a street car since you're doing lexan (btw, I don;t think will save you too much).
